Abstract

Xylanase is an enzyme that has an ability to hydrolyze hemicellulose and has an important act in such as industries, so that should be immobilized so that it can be used repeatedly and easy to removed from the product. In this study, xylanase isolated from the fungus Trichoderma viride and purified by using ammonium sulfate saturation levels 40-80%. The method that used in the immobilization of xylanase is a method of trapping using a matrix of chitosan-tripolyphosphate with make a variation to chitosan concentration (0.5, 1.0, 1.5, 2.0, 2.5)% (w / v) and make a variation to enzyme concentration (0.5, 1.5, 2.5, 3.5, 4.5) mg / mL. The results showed that the chitosan concentration optimum is at a concentration  2.0% with the amount of xylanase stuck at  such as 3.867 mg. Enzyme concentration optimum is at a concentration of 4.5 mg / mL with the amount of xylanase stuck such as 18.942 mg.
